In the high-octane world of Indian cinema, where image is currency and every frame is scrutinized, the topic of wardrobe malfunctions—particularly so-called "nip slips"—has become a recurring flashpoint in public discourse. While such incidents are often sensationalized by tabloids and amplified through social media outrage, they reflect deeper issues within the entertainment industry: the relentless pressure on female performers to conform to hyper-sexualized aesthetics, the invasive gaze of digital culture, and the gendered double standards that govern public morality. Unlike their Western counterparts, where figures like Jennifer Lawrence or Adele have reclaimed narratives around body autonomy, Indian actresses often face disproportionate backlash when such moments occur, revealing a cultural paradox where glamour is demanded but vulnerability is punished.

The 2023 Cannes Film Festival saw a surge in online chatter when a leading Bollywood actress, dressed in a sheer embellished gown, experienced a wardrobe malfunction during a red carpet appearance. Though the moment was fleeting and arguably unintentional, it quickly spiraled into a viral scandal, with memes, judgmental commentary, and even calls for censorship flooding Indian social media. This isn't an isolated case. From Deepika Padukone’s backless ensemble at a 2019 premiere to Ananya Panday’s off-shoulder gown mishap at a promotional event, young actresses are frequently caught in a bind—expected to project boldness and modernity while being policed for the slightest deviation from conservative norms. The irony is palpable: designers in India and abroad craft daring silhouettes for these stars, yet the burden of accountability falls solely on the wearer when things go awry.

The discourse around such incidents cannot be divorced from the broader context of gender dynamics in South Asia. While male actors like Ranveer Singh have worn flamboyant, skin-baring outfits without public censure, actresses are often labeled "attention-seeking" or "immodest" for similar choices. This double standard is not merely cultural—it's institutional. Indian media regulation bodies have historically targeted female performers for "indecency," while turning a blind eye to overtly sexualized male leads. The result is a climate where women are both objectified and shamed, caught in a cycle of performative sexuality and moral policing.

Moreover, the digital age has intensified this scrutiny. High-resolution photography, 4K video, and instant social media sharing mean that even micro-moments are dissected frame by frame. What might have been a passing breeze at a film premiere in the 1990s now becomes a trending topic with millions of views. The psychological toll on performers is immense. As actress Vidya Balan once remarked in an interview, "We are expected to be flawless mannequins, but we are human beings with bodies that move, breathe, and exist beyond the lens."

The solution lies not in further regulation or modesty campaigns, but in a cultural recalibration—one that shifts focus from bodily exposure to artistic contribution, from scandal to substance. When global stars like Zendaya or Rihanna use fashion as empowerment, India’s industry must allow its actresses the same autonomy. Until then, every "slip" will be less about fabric and more about the fragile seams holding together tradition, modernity, and gender equity in one of the world’s largest entertainment ecosystems.
